IA: US61 Louisa County line to north of Wapello
« on: December 04, 2017, 03:08:34 am »
The 4 lane section is in use.  There is still some shoulder work going on so cones were up headed southbound, but the cones were down going northbound.  The exit by Louisa-Muscatine High School is exit 76.  I didn't catch and remember the exit number for IA92 at Grandview, but Mapnik shows it is 74.
